one. What exactly is PVD Coating?
PVD (Physical Vapor Deposition) is often a process where by skinny coatings are deposited on substrates in a vacuum natural environment. Utilizing procedures like sputtering, arc evaporation, and electron beam deposition, PVD produces remarkably tough, don-resistant, and visually interesting coatings on metals, ceramics, glass, and polymers. These coatings can make improvements to hardness, minimize friction, raise put on resistance, and provide corrosion defense, making them appropriate for chopping tools, decorative apps, and purposeful factors.

2. Varieties of PVD Coating Gear
The type of PVD coating products desired depends upon the resources and ideal Attributes of the coating. Frequent sorts involve:

Sputtering Systems: Make use of significant-Vitality plasma to eject atoms from the concentrate on material, which then deposit on the substrate. Sputtering is well-liked for electronic components and thin-movie purposes.
Arc Evaporation Units: Utilize a significant-Electricity arc to vaporize a good product right into a plasma condition, which then deposits onto the substrate. This method is preferred for developing tricky coatings on tools.
Electron Beam Evaporation Units: Warmth resources using an electron beam until finally they vaporize, making smooth, uniform coatings normally Utilized in optics and semiconductors.
3. Vacuum Coating Machines
Vacuum coating equipment are significant in PVD procedures, as they make a Pvd Equipments controlled atmosphere free from contaminants which could have an impact on the caliber of the coating. Various equipment concentrate on various apps, like:

Superior Vacuum Pvd Coating Equipments Programs: Attain extremely-lower pressure for exact coating, frequently Utilized in semiconductor manufacturing.
Batch Coaters: Approach numerous sections simultaneously, ideal for superior-volume generation, generally employed for attractive coatings and durable surfaces on client merchandise.
Inline Coating Machines: Created for continual manufacturing, with substrates transferring together a conveyor. These are typically employed for coating significant batches of smaller sized objects competently.
4. Programs of PVD Products
PVD machines finds application across several fields, from ornamental coatings on watches and jewellery to purposeful coatings on automotive pieces, electronics, and health-related units. Critical great things about PVD coatings consist of:

Sturdiness and Dress in Resistance: Ideal for industrial equipment that have to have superior hardness and low friction, like drill bits and reducing resources.
Decorative Finishes: Generates eye-catching finishes in a variety of shades (gold, chrome, black) for client products like watches, phones, and eyeglass frames.
Optical Coatings: Improves the functionality of lenses, mirrors, and screens by controlling reflection and transmission Qualities.
